For W98/2000, I need a small, prefer no-install mail client that can
send/receive plain text in POP3, has a basic GUI interface, one account is
OK. Save incoming mail, outgoing mail in folders.
Being able to view HTML mail is desired, as some tech newsletters come that
way.
I use Popcorn, it is an excellent spam checker, works as above but can't
handle HTML.
Scribe has a black/grey GUI, difficult to view.
Kaufman Mail Warrior works fine but crashes, as explained in help file, so
N/A
Magic Mail Monitor seems to just be a mail checker.
Any other possibilities?
